Output d1eac3cb41f571de6f2842af8b365ede26014f6ecdc1c39e5da04ea7566a85f6:3

value
1597446
script pubkey
OP_0 OP_PUSHBYTES_20 3f87647021246ac0652c2168b519d4dea6badeaf
address
bc1q87rkguppy34vqefvy95t2xw5m6nt4h40htjfyq
transaction
d1eac3cb41f571de6f2842af8b365ede26014f6ecdc1c39e5da04ea7566a85f6
confirmations
187622
spent
true